Understanding Export Compliance: A Must for B2B Manufacturers

The Importance of Export Compliance

For B2B manufacturers, understanding export compliance is not just a legal obligation; it's a crucial aspect of running a successful business in the global market.

Key Regulations to Consider

Manufacturers must stay informed about various international regulations that govern the export of goods. These include, but are not limited to, export controls, trade sanctions, and customs regulations.

Developing Compliance Procedures

Establishing robust compliance procedures can help manufacturers mitigate risks associated with exporting. This includes training staff on compliance requirements, conducting regular audits, and implementing a clear reporting process for any violations.

The Benefits of Compliance

Adhering to export compliance regulations goes beyond avoiding penalties. Compliance can enhance a manufacturer's reputation, build trust with clients, and open up new market opportunities.

Staying Updated with Changes

Regulations are continually evolving. Manufacturers must stay updated with changes in trade laws and compliance requirements to ensure ongoing adherence and minimize disruptions in their operations.

Conclusion

Understanding export compliance is essential for B2B manufacturers aiming to thrive in the global marketplace. By prioritizing compliance, manufacturers can safeguard their operations and achieve sustainable growth.
